http://course.sdu.edu.cn/G2S/eWebEditor/uploadfile/20121213093025493.pdf WebSep 13, 2024 · The modulation index of a FM signal is a measure of how much the carrier frequency deviates as a result of the modulating frequency. Formula h = fd / fm Where, fm is the highest frequency component present in the modulating signal fd is the maximum deviation of the instantaneous frequency from the carrier frequency Calculator Examples
Webtelemetry are Frequency Modulation (FM) and Phase Modulation (PM). Pulse Code Modulation (PCM)/Frequency Modulation (FM) has been the most popular telemetry modulation since around 1970. The PCM/FM method could also be called filtered Continuous Phase Frequency Shift Keying (CPFSK). The RF signal is typically …
